SWM SM 500 R 2020

SWM SM 500 R 2020

The SM 500R is not a thoroughbred supermoto that only wants to be ridden on the kart track. You can have fun with it there, too, but narrow bends and mountain passes are its home. Thanks to its comfortable seat and pleasant riding position, it is also happy to go on short tours. In addition to the well-known components, SWM also focuses on a reasonable price.

easy to ride

very good handling

very comfortable for a Supermoto

At 140 kg, a bit heavy for a single-cylinder

ABS regulates very early on
